Kako namestiti uradne gonilnike NVIDIA GPU na Proxmox VE 8

Kako Namestiti Uradne Gonilnike Nvidia Gpu Na Proxmox Ve 8



Običajno ne potrebujete GPE-ja na strežniku Proxmox VE za zagon virtualnih strojev. Ampak če hočeš omogočite 3D pospeševanje (z uporabo VirtIO-GL ali VirGL) na vaših virtualnih strojih Proxmox VE , oz prehod skozi GPU na vsebniku Proxmox VE za pospeševanje AI/CUDA , boste potrebovali GPE in zahtevane gonilnike GPE, nameščene na vašem strežniku Proxmox VE.

V tem članku vam bomo pokazali, kako namestite najnovejšo različico uradnih gonilnikov NVIDIA GPE na Proxmox VE 8, tako da jih lahko uporabljate za pospeševanje VirIO-GL/VirGL 3D na svojih virtualnih strojih Proxmox VE ali prehod skozi vaš NVIDIA GPE na Vsebniki Proxmox VE za pospeševanje AI/CUDA.







Tema vsebine:

Preverjanje, ali je na vašem strežniku Proxmox VE nameščen NVIDIA GPE

Če želite namestiti gonilnike NVIDIA GPU na strežnik Proxmox VE, morate imeti na strežniku nameščeno strojno opremo NVIDIA GPU. Če potrebujete pomoč pri preverjanju, ali imate na svojem strežniku na voljo/nameščeno strojno opremo NVIDIA GPE, .



Omogočanje repozitorijev paketov skupnosti Proxmox VE (izbirno za poslovne uporabnike)

Če nimate poslovne naročnine Proxmox VE, morate omogočite repozitorije paketov skupnosti Proxmox VE za namestitev zahtevanih datotek glave za prevajanje gonilnikov NVIDIA GPU za vaš strežnik Proxmox VE.



Posodabljanje predpomnilnika baze podatkov paketa Proxmox VE

Ko omogočite repozitorije paketov skupnosti Proxmox VE, pojdite na pve > školjka z nadzorne plošče Proxmox VE in zaženite naslednji ukaz za posodobitev predpomnilnika baze podatkov paketa Proxmox VE:





$ primerna posodobitev

Namestitev glav jedra Proxmox VE na Proxmox VE

Glave jedra Proxmox VE so potrebne za prevajanje modulov jedra gonilnikov NVIDIA GPU.



Če želite namestiti glave jedra Proxmox VE na strežnik Proxmox VE, zaženite naslednji ukaz:

$ apt namestite -in pve-headers-$ ( uname -r )

Glave jedra Promox VE morajo biti nameščene na vašem strežniku Proxmox VE.

Namestitev zahtevanih odvisnosti za gonilnike GPU NVIDIA na Proxmox VE

Če želite zgraditi module jedra gonilnikov NVIDIA GPU, morate na strežnik Proxmox VE namestiti tudi nekaj paketov odvisnosti.

Če želite namestiti vse zahtevane pakete odvisnosti na vaš strežnik Proxmox VE, zaženite naslednji ukaz:

$ apt namestite build-essential pkg-config xorg xorg-dev libglvnd0 libglvnd-dev

Za potrditev namestitve pritisnite “Y” in nato pritisnite .

Zahtevani paketi odvisnosti se prenašajo iz interneta. Za dokončanje traja nekaj časa.

Zahtevani paketi odvisnosti se nameščajo. Za dokončanje traja nekaj časa.

Na tej točki bi morali biti zahtevani paketi odvisnosti nameščeni na vašem strežniku Proxmox VE.

Prenos najnovejše različice gonilnikov NVIDIA GPU za Proxmox VE

Če želite prenesti najnovejšo različico uradne namestitvene datoteke gonilnikov NVIDIA GPU za Proxmox VE, obiščite iz katerega koli spletnega brskalnika.

Ko se stran naloži, v spustnih menijih »Vrsta izdelka«, »Serija izdelkov« in »Izdelek« izberite svoj GPE [1] . Za »Operacijski sistem« izberite »Linux 64-bit« [2] , »Proizvodna podružnica« kot »Vrsta prenosa« [3] in kliknite »Išči« [4] .

Kliknite »Prenesi«.

Z desno miškino tipko (RMB) kliknite »Strinjam se in prenesi« in kliknite »Kopiraj povezavo«, da kopirate povezavo za prenos namestitvene datoteke gonilnikov NVIDIA GPU.

Zdaj se vrnite v lupino Proxmox VE in vnesite ukaz »wget«. [1] , pritisnite , z desno miškino tipko kliknite (RMB) lupino Proxmox VE in kliknite »Prilepi« [2] da prilepite povezavo za prenos gonilnikov NVIDIA GPU.

Ko je povezava za prenos prilepljena na lupino Proxmox VE, pritisnite za zagon ukaza za prenos gonilnikov GPU NVIDIA:

$ wget https: // us.download.nvidia.com / XFree86 / Linux-x86_64 / 535.146.02 / NVIDIA-Linux-x86_64-535.146.02.run

Namestitvena datoteka gonilnikov NVIDIA GPU se prenaša. Za dokončanje traja nekaj časa.

Na tej točki je treba prenesti namestitveno datoteko gonilnikov NVIDIA GPU.

Najdete lahko namestitveno datoteko gonilnikov NVIDIA GPU ( NVIDIA-Linux-x86_64-535.146.02.run v našem primeru) v domačem imeniku vašega strežnika Proxmox VE.

$ ls -lh

Namestitev gonilnikov NVIDIA GPU na Proxmox VE

Preden lahko zaženete namestitveno datoteko gonilnikov NVIDIA GPU na vašem strežniku Proxmox VE, dodajte izvršljivo dovoljenje v namestitveno datoteko gonilnikov NVIDIA GPU, kot sledi:

$ chmod +x NVIDIA-Linux-x86_64-535.146.02.run

Zdaj zaženite namestitveno datoteko gonilnikov NVIDIA GPU, kot sledi:

$ . / NVIDIA-Linux-x86_64-535.146.02.run

Gonilniki GPE NVIDIA se zdaj nameščajo na vaš strežnik Proxmox VE. Prevajanje vseh modulov jedra gonilnikov NVIDIA GPU za strežnik Proxmox VE traja nekaj časa.

Ko boste pozvani, da namestite 32-bitne združljive knjižnice NVIDIA, izberite »Da« in pritisnite .

Namestitev gonilnikov NVIDIA GPE bi se morala nadaljevati.

Ko se prikaže naslednji poziv, izberite »Da« in pritisnite .

Pritisnite .

Gonilniki NVIDIA GPE bi morali biti nameščeni na vašem strežniku Proxmox VE.

Da bodo spremembe začele veljati, znova zaženite strežnik Proxmox VE z naslednjim ukazom:

$ ponovni zagon

Preverjanje, ali so gonilniki NVIDIA GPU pravilno nameščeni na Proxmox VE

Če želite preveriti, ali so gonilniki GPE NVIDIA pravilno nameščeni na strežniku Proxmox VE, zaženite naslednji ukaz iz lupine Proxmox VE:

$ lsmod | prijem nvidia

Če so gonilniki NVIDIA GPU pravilno nameščeni na vašem strežniku Proxmox VE, bi morali biti moduli jedra NVIDIA naloženi, kot lahko vidite na naslednjem posnetku zaslona:

Uporabite lahko tudi ukaz »nvidia-smi«, da preverite, ali gonilniki GPU NVIDIA delujejo pravilno. Kot lahko vidite, ukaz »nvidia-smi« kaže, da imamo NVIDIA GeForce RTX 4070 (12 GB) [1][2] različica nameščena na našem strežniku Proxmox VE in uporabljamo gonilnike NVIDIA GPU različice 535.146.02 [3] .

$ nvidia-smi

Zaključek

V tem članku smo vam pokazali, kako prenesete in namestite najnovejšo različico uradnih gonilnikov NVIDIA GPU na vaš strežnik Proxmox VE. Gonilniki NVIDIA GPU morajo biti nameščeni na vašem strežniku Proxmox VE, če želite uporabiti svoj NVIDIA GPE za omogočanje pospeševanja VirtIO-GL/VirGL 3D na virtualnih strojih Proxmox VE ali prehod skozi NVIDIA GPE do vsebnikov Proxmox VE LXC za pospeševanje AI/CUDA .